A year last Christmas (2012)

 

My daughter bought me a Grundig mixer, the cast iron one.

 

A few weeks ago it started developing a fault, Turns itself on randomly, then turns itself off and wont turn on again. The lights on it flash randomly.

 

I rang their customer service line this morning and was asked to provide proof of purchase, which i dont have as it was a gift.

 

I have spoken to my daughter who told me she bought it from a catalogue and paid cash weekly it.

she is now trying to get hold of the woman who had the catalogue to see if she has POP.

 

Grundig CS informed me that the machine is under warranty for 3 years but the 1st year is with the company it was purchased from.

Which is why they need POP. I

 

pointed out that it was a gift and after the 17 months since it was bought getting hold of the POP might prove difficult

but they told me that without POP there is nothing they can do.

 

Something i find hard to believe from such a well known company such as this and i had the feeling that i was being fobbed off.

Link to post
Share on other sites

Hi fitty

 

Grundig can look up the age of the product from the serial number. The catalogue company should resolve this under SOGA. Send them a template Recorded Delivery. You might have to get an independent report on the faulty product, the cost should be reimbursed by the catalogue company.

This afternoon i got an email back from the query i submitted on Grundigs website. The email was from Beko stating......

Thank you for your email.

"Unfortunately we didn’t manufacture or distribute these products and are therefore unable to offer any assistance. We can only suggest that you contact your retailer or supplier for further assistance."

I rung and spoke to Beko and said i was confused but it seems that Beko and Grundig are one and the same company, They were unable to help but transferred me through to another technical help line. This helpline was in fact Goodmans who told me there was nothing they could do as Grundig are no longer supported. What that means exactly i have no idea .

As i said before the item was purchased through Studio Cards should i now try and seek a replacement through them?
